Overview
Manager of HRIS (Workday) at Ken Garff Automotive Group. Hybrid schedule (minimum of three days in office) at the corporate office in Salt Lake City, UT. The role focuses on Workday as the primary HRIS, driving people analytics and data-driven decision making across corporate, regional and dealership levels. The position requires strong analytics, project management, and the ability to translate data into actionable solutions for the business. Responsibilities
Partners with key stakeholders to understand the business needs for people data, analytics and meaningful reporting. Leads the design and delivery of HRIS reporting systems (Workday); serves as the project manager over new product modules or HCM systems. Designs, implements and maintains initiatives that support efficient operations such as employee and manager self-service. Leads new Workday product modules, functionality, and solutions that align Workday processes and data with business needs. Serves as the technical point of contact for Workday operational areas and assists with troubleshooting and problem-solving. Leads upgrades and releases, communicating with HR partners, employees, and managers. Designs training material and collaborates with HR leadership to normalize and disseminate. Maintains Ken Garff Custom Reports and reviews their relevance with stakeholders. Meets monthly with the HR Leadership team to review data, analytics and current reporting tools and discuss future needs and system solutions. Interacts with senior executives to promote system and data solutions to HR business challenges, providing relevant presentations as needed. Continually learns the HRIS software through Workday learning resources to improve the overall Workday experience for employees.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in HR Information Systems, Business, or Human Resources; Master's degree preferred. A minimum of 5 years of progressive Workday experience. Integration experience heavily preferred. Strong project management skills to lead and manage multiple projects at the design and implementation level. Ability to comprehend data sources and utilize critical thinking to create solutions to business challenges using data. Job Details
